Objectives
Narrative objectives1 To examine the epicardial adipose tissue by using a cardiac CT examination for patients with atrial fibrillation and to evaluate the relationship about the onset, the mechanism and pathology of atrial fibrillation.
Basic objectives2 Others
Basic objectives -Others meaning of examination
Trial characteristics_1 Exploratory
Trial characteristics_2 Explanatory
Developmental phase Not applicable

Assessment
Primary outcomes recurrence of atrial fibrillation after catheter ablation therapy
Key secondary outcomes 1)distribution, accumulation and property of epicardial adipose tissue
2)blood examination
3)echocardiography

Eligibility
Age-lower limit

Not applicable
Age-upper limit

Not applicable
Gender Male and Female
Key inclusion criteria 1)Diagnosed as atrial fibrillation by electrocardiogram
2)After catheter ablation therapy for atrial ablation
3)cardiac CT examination before the ablation
Key exclusion criteria 1)moderate or severe valvular disease
2)reduced cardiac function (left ventricular ejection fraction<55%)
3)severe obese cases (BMI>30kg/m2)
4)heart failure cases (BNP>200pg/ml)
5)history of open-heart surgery
6)inflammatory or infection disease cases
7)Patients rejected the use of clinical data
Target sample size 100

Results The mean epicardial addipose tissue density using CT was significantly higher in the patients with paroxysmal atrial fibrillation than in control patients.
Published from Journal of Cardiology. 2016; 68: 406-411.
Other related information We investigate the recurrence of atrial fibrillation after the catheter ablation, and evaluate the distribution,t and CT values of epicardial adipose tissue by cardiac CT.
